ACT domestic violence workers trained to better respond to technological abuse

By Megan Gorrey
Updated April 23 2018 - 10:12pm, first published August 7 2015 - 3:53pm

Frontline domestic violence workers in the ACT will be trained to protect women whose violent ex-partners have used technology to stalk, intimidate and harass them.
